Product Description: When Wilma the witch leaves her pet rat and fat cat at home with a crazy broom, they get into all kinds of silly trouble. The fat cat takes the rat’s place on top of the mat—and won’t get off. The broom and the rat try their hardest to get the fat cat to move—but to no avail...read more
